Queer Exceptions: Solo Performance in Neoliberal Times - Theatre: Theory – Practice – Performance Stephen Greer
Queer Exceptions: Solo Performance in Neoliberal Times - Theatre: Theory – Practice – Performance
Stephen Greer
A major study of solo performance in the UK and Europe that examines the significance of exceptional lives in neoliberal times. With case studies drawn from theatre, comedy and live art, it combines insights from gender studies, politics and sociology to present a new queer account of subjectivity at the start of the twenty-first century. -- .
